What to expect
If hired as an all around entertainer I generally start off my show by walking the crowd and doing card tricks to warm up the crowd. I generally work like this for approx. 30 minutes (longer or shorter if requested) and begin to set up my materials. When doing my fire performance I walk the audience through my routine trick by trick, steadily increasing in difficulty and time with fire on my body or in my mouth. As a final performance I breathe fire in a variety of ways (split flames, spinning torches, breathing fire off of a hand that has been lit on fire) and finish my show with a bow.

Additional booking notes
Staging is the largest requirement for my show as it is a fire performance. A large area should be cleared with room for people to be 15 feet away from me at times. A large overhead is usually required as well, at least 8 feet from floor, as I perform tricks with 24 inch torches in my mouth.
Lighting should be low for the stage to enhance the enjoyment of the audience. Soft reds or blues are usually the colors of choice.
A sound system is preferred but not required as I can perform with or without music. If a certain song is requested I will try my best to fit it in.
